• Home
  • Chat IA
  • Guru IA
  • Tutores
  • Central de ajuda
Home
Chat IA
Guru IA
Tutores

·

Engenharia de Computação ·

Engenharia de Software

Envie sua pergunta para a IA e receba a resposta na hora

Recomendado para você

Links de Vídeos Educacionais do YouTube

1

Links de Vídeos Educacionais do YouTube

Engenharia de Software

FIT

Links para Vídeos do YouTube

1

Links para Vídeos do YouTube

Engenharia de Software

FIT

Teoria da Computação

7

Teoria da Computação

Engenharia de Software

FIT

Desenvolvimento Web Parte 08: Eventos em JavaScript

31

Desenvolvimento Web Parte 08: Eventos em JavaScript

Engenharia de Software

FIT

Prova DevOps Git e Testes - Faculdade Impacta

6

Prova DevOps Git e Testes - Faculdade Impacta

Engenharia de Software

FIT

Ac2 - Análise Exploratória de Dados

16

Ac2 - Análise Exploratória de Dados

Engenharia de Software

FIT

Ac3 Analise Exploratoria de Dados

8

Ac3 Analise Exploratoria de Dados

Engenharia de Software

FIT

Projeto de Circuitos Digitais

6

Projeto de Circuitos Digitais

Engenharia de Software

FIT

Engenharia de Software - Playlist Completa YouTube

1

Engenharia de Software - Playlist Completa YouTube

Engenharia de Software

FIT

Server Side Rendering: Criação de Páginas Dinâmicas

26

Server Side Rendering: Criação de Páginas Dinâmicas

Engenharia de Software

FIT

Texto de pré-visualização

whatsapp 11 996164142 O padrão MVC é utilizado em muitos projetos devido à arquitetura que possui o que possibilita a divisão do projeto em camadas muito definidas o Model o Controller e a View A respeito desse padrão assinale a alternativa correta A View processa a rota que irá responder a requisição do usuário Para isso ela deve receber essa requisição diretamente O Controller é a ponte entre o Model e a View Ele recebe a requisição do usuário é responsável pelo fluxo de dados e de trabalho da aplicação além de decidir o caminho da resposta do processamento O Model é a camada que recebe requisições dos clientes e decide o tipo de visualização mais adequado O papel do Controller é gerar a visualização dos dados que será encaminhada ao cliente A View contém a lógica de negócio e pode acessar por exemplo o banco de dados Dada a aplicação em Flask a seguir qual será a resposta do servidor ao acessar a rota principal from flask import Flask app Flaskname approuteprincipal def abertura return abcdef def principal return 123456 approuteprincipalabertura def principalabertura return abcdef123456 if name main apprun 123456 Não há nenhum controle configurado para responder à rota principal 123456abcdef abcdef abcdef123456 Imagine a seguinte configuração de rotas no Flask Marque a única URL que NÃO redireciona para nenhum Controller approute def index return rendertemplateindexhtml approutecursos def cursos return rendertemplatecursoshtml approutecursossigla def cursosigla return rendertemplatecursohtml nomesigla approutecursossigladisc def disciplinassigla return rendertemplatedisciplinashtml discsigla approutecursossigladiscintid def cursoscomsiglaidsigla id return rendertemplatecursos2html nomecursosigla codcursoid httplocalhost5000cursosadsdisc4 httplocalhost5000 httplocalhost5000cursosadsdisc httplocalhost5000cursosadsdiscTecWeb httplocalhost5000cursos Considere o controller do código Python a seguir Qual das alternativas substitui de forma correta os trechos destacados em números romanos para que o template mostre todos os nomes dos alunos enviados pelo controller em uma lista definida pela tag ul Trecho de código apppy approute alunos def alunos listaalunos Ana João Maria Pedro return rendertemplatealunoshtml alunoslistaalunos Trecho de código template alunoshtml ul classlistagemalunos I liIIli III ul I for aluno in alunos II aluno III endfor I for aluno in alunos II aluno III end I for item in lista II aluno III end I for item in alunos II item III end I for item in listaalunos II aluno III endfor Qual a template tag do Flask usamos para herdar a estrutura de um outro template nesse caso do template basehtml basehtml implements basehtml extends basehtml basehtml inherits basehtml Considerando o fluxo de autenticação de um usuário qual dos seguintes passos NÃO seria necessário no processo Criação do objeto de sessão do usuário no servidor Verificação e conversão do nome de usuário para letras maiúsculas através do evento onchange no atributo input Verificação da existência do usuário e da senha enviados Envio do usuário e senha ao servidor Definição do cookie de sessão no navegador e redirecionamento para a área logada Supondo que um formulário envie dados para a rota cadastro no servidor usando o método POST como podemos recuperar dentro de um controle do Flask a informação associada ao name cpf enviada pelo formulário requestargsgetcpf requestgetcpf requestformgetcpf requestcpf sessioncpf O AJAX é uma tecnologia usada para desenvolvimento de sites interativos A abordagem de desenvolvimento tradicional tem semelhanças e diferenças em relação ao AJAX Uma característica exclusiva do AJAX em relação à abordagem tradicional é que Usa Javascript como linguagem para desenvolver código no lado do servidor Representa os objetos no lado cliente com DOM Executa somente requisições síncronas através do protocolo HTTP Permite recuperação assíncrona de dados usando XMLHttpRequest ou fetch API Usa HTMLCSS como linguagem de templates para definir o aspecto visual da página Sobre o objeto XMLHttpRequest assinale a alternativa verdadeira Permite apenas requisitar URLs que retornam informações no formato XML de maneira assíncrona não sendo aceitos outros formatos de dados O evento readyState é disparado toda vez que ocorre uma mudança no atributo responseText A propriedade status será igual a 405 quando a requisição terminar de forma bem sucedida O atributo responseText contém a resposta enviada pelo servidor após uma requisição Permite apenas requisições com o método GET O JSON é um formato para representação de dados leve comumente usado para transferência de informações entre o servidor e o cliente Sobre esse formato assinale a alternativa correta No formato JSON os dados devem sempre estar entre colchetes É um formato para armazenar um conjunto de dados em formato binário As chaves podem ser de qualquer tipo e não é possível definir um JSON com apenas uma chave e um valor É um formato similar ao dicionário do Python onde os dados são armazenados no formato chavevalor Todas as chaves devem ser strings e os valores podem ser de vários tipos de dados strings números booleanos null vetores e inclusive outros objetos JSON É uma linguagem similar ao XML que utiliza marcações com os símbolos para definir chaves e valores No Flask podemos criar uma string no formato JSON através da função rendertemplate

Envie sua pergunta para a IA e receba a resposta na hora

Recomendado para você

Links de Vídeos Educacionais do YouTube

1

Links de Vídeos Educacionais do YouTube

Engenharia de Software

FIT

Links para Vídeos do YouTube

1

Links para Vídeos do YouTube

Engenharia de Software

FIT

Teoria da Computação

7

Teoria da Computação

Engenharia de Software

FIT

Desenvolvimento Web Parte 08: Eventos em JavaScript

31

Desenvolvimento Web Parte 08: Eventos em JavaScript

Engenharia de Software

FIT

Prova DevOps Git e Testes - Faculdade Impacta

6

Prova DevOps Git e Testes - Faculdade Impacta

Engenharia de Software

FIT

Ac2 - Análise Exploratória de Dados

16

Ac2 - Análise Exploratória de Dados

Engenharia de Software

FIT

Ac3 Analise Exploratoria de Dados

8

Ac3 Analise Exploratoria de Dados

Engenharia de Software

FIT

Projeto de Circuitos Digitais

6

Projeto de Circuitos Digitais

Engenharia de Software

FIT

Engenharia de Software - Playlist Completa YouTube

1

Engenharia de Software - Playlist Completa YouTube

Engenharia de Software

FIT

Server Side Rendering: Criação de Páginas Dinâmicas

26

Server Side Rendering: Criação de Páginas Dinâmicas

Engenharia de Software

FIT

Texto de pré-visualização

whatsapp 11 996164142 O padrão MVC é utilizado em muitos projetos devido à arquitetura que possui o que possibilita a divisão do projeto em camadas muito definidas o Model o Controller e a View A respeito desse padrão assinale a alternativa correta A View processa a rota que irá responder a requisição do usuário Para isso ela deve receber essa requisição diretamente O Controller é a ponte entre o Model e a View Ele recebe a requisição do usuário é responsável pelo fluxo de dados e de trabalho da aplicação além de decidir o caminho da resposta do processamento O Model é a camada que recebe requisições dos clientes e decide o tipo de visualização mais adequado O papel do Controller é gerar a visualização dos dados que será encaminhada ao cliente A View contém a lógica de negócio e pode acessar por exemplo o banco de dados Dada a aplicação em Flask a seguir qual será a resposta do servidor ao acessar a rota principal from flask import Flask app Flaskname approuteprincipal def abertura return abcdef def principal return 123456 approuteprincipalabertura def principalabertura return abcdef123456 if name main apprun 123456 Não há nenhum controle configurado para responder à rota principal 123456abcdef abcdef abcdef123456 Imagine a seguinte configuração de rotas no Flask Marque a única URL que NÃO redireciona para nenhum Controller approute def index return rendertemplateindexhtml approutecursos def cursos return rendertemplatecursoshtml approutecursossigla def cursosigla return rendertemplatecursohtml nomesigla approutecursossigladisc def disciplinassigla return rendertemplatedisciplinashtml discsigla approutecursossigladiscintid def cursoscomsiglaidsigla id return rendertemplatecursos2html nomecursosigla codcursoid httplocalhost5000cursosadsdisc4 httplocalhost5000 httplocalhost5000cursosadsdisc httplocalhost5000cursosadsdiscTecWeb httplocalhost5000cursos Considere o controller do código Python a seguir Qual das alternativas substitui de forma correta os trechos destacados em números romanos para que o template mostre todos os nomes dos alunos enviados pelo controller em uma lista definida pela tag ul Trecho de código apppy approute alunos def alunos listaalunos Ana João Maria Pedro return rendertemplatealunoshtml alunoslistaalunos Trecho de código template alunoshtml ul classlistagemalunos I liIIli III ul I for aluno in alunos II aluno III endfor I for aluno in alunos II aluno III end I for item in lista II aluno III end I for item in alunos II item III end I for item in listaalunos II aluno III endfor Qual a template tag do Flask usamos para herdar a estrutura de um outro template nesse caso do template basehtml basehtml implements basehtml extends basehtml basehtml inherits basehtml Considerando o fluxo de autenticação de um usuário qual dos seguintes passos NÃO seria necessário no processo Criação do objeto de sessão do usuário no servidor Verificação e conversão do nome de usuário para letras maiúsculas através do evento onchange no atributo input Verificação da existência do usuário e da senha enviados Envio do usuário e senha ao servidor Definição do cookie de sessão no navegador e redirecionamento para a área logada Supondo que um formulário envie dados para a rota cadastro no servidor usando o método POST como podemos recuperar dentro de um controle do Flask a informação associada ao name cpf enviada pelo formulário requestargsgetcpf requestgetcpf requestformgetcpf requestcpf sessioncpf O AJAX é uma tecnologia usada para desenvolvimento de sites interativos A abordagem de desenvolvimento tradicional tem semelhanças e diferenças em relação ao AJAX Uma característica exclusiva do AJAX em relação à abordagem tradicional é que Usa Javascript como linguagem para desenvolver código no lado do servidor Representa os objetos no lado cliente com DOM Executa somente requisições síncronas através do protocolo HTTP Permite recuperação assíncrona de dados usando XMLHttpRequest ou fetch API Usa HTMLCSS como linguagem de templates para definir o aspecto visual da página Sobre o objeto XMLHttpRequest assinale a alternativa verdadeira Permite apenas requisitar URLs que retornam informações no formato XML de maneira assíncrona não sendo aceitos outros formatos de dados O evento readyState é disparado toda vez que ocorre uma mudança no atributo responseText A propriedade status será igual a 405 quando a requisição terminar de forma bem sucedida O atributo responseText contém a resposta enviada pelo servidor após uma requisição Permite apenas requisições com o método GET O JSON é um formato para representação de dados leve comumente usado para transferência de informações entre o servidor e o cliente Sobre esse formato assinale a alternativa correta No formato JSON os dados devem sempre estar entre colchetes É um formato para armazenar um conjunto de dados em formato binário As chaves podem ser de qualquer tipo e não é possível definir um JSON com apenas uma chave e um valor É um formato similar ao dicionário do Python onde os dados são armazenados no formato chavevalor Todas as chaves devem ser strings e os valores podem ser de vários tipos de dados strings números booleanos null vetores e inclusive outros objetos JSON É uma linguagem similar ao XML que utiliza marcações com os símbolos para definir chaves e valores No Flask podemos criar uma string no formato JSON através da função rendertemplate

Sua Nova Sala de Aula

Sua Nova Sala de Aula

Empresa

Central de ajuda Contato Blog

Legal

Termos de uso Política de privacidade Política de cookies Código de honra

Baixe o app

4,8
(35.000 avaliações)
© 2025 Meu Guru®